Browse Restaurantsl'Osteria - Faro

l'Osteria - FaroFaro

Italian€€€

Want to receive alerts for l'Osteria - Faro?

Quality in service, quality in ingredients, quality in environment, quality in details. This is our best definition for a genuinely Italian house with an Italian Chef in the heart of Faro!

Experiences at l'Osteria - Faro

  • Reservation

    Standard Reservation

    Quality in service, quality in ingredients, quality in environment, quality in details. This is our best definition for a genuinely Italian house with an Italian Chef in the heart of Faro!